Equity curve
Spending by category
Monthly budget
Add manual wallet
Balance tracker: credits/debits do NOT count as income/expense (e.g. Zelle, cash).
Add holding
Portfolio Holdings
On-chain Balances
On-chain Holdings
Live token balances from your Trezor across ETH, ARB, BASE and BSC. Read-only — not counted in any totals.
P2P Spread
?Sell USDT → buy USD at lower rate → reconvert via BDV→Bpay. Shows raw P2P spread and effective net gain after fees.
Sell
Buy
BDV to Bpay
?Bank fees: 1% then 1.5% on total · Bpay keeps 3.3% of the recharge
BDV (bank balance $)
BDV to Wally
?Bank fees: 1% then 1.5% on total · Wally fee: 3.5% + 7% ITBMS on commission = 3.745% charged upfront
BDV (bank balance $)
BDV to Zinli
?Bank fees: 1% then 1.5% on total · Zinli fee: 3.75% charged upfront
BDV (bank balance $)
Binance API
Credentials stored in Cloudflare Worker env vars (BINANCE_KEY, BINANCE_SECRET).
Bybit API
Credentials stored in Cloudflare Worker env vars (BYBIT_KEY, BYBIT_SECRET).
OKX API
Credentials stored in Cloudflare Worker env vars (OKX_KEY, OKX_SECRET, OKX_PASSPHRASE).
Cloud sync
Data syncs automatically to Cloudflare KV on every change.
Data
Import CSV
Columns: Date, Description, Wallet, Transaction, Category, Amount, Tracker
Duplicates (same date + description + amount) are skipped automatically.
Click or drag your CSV here